Serving 433 students in grades Prekindergarten-12, Leland ºÚÁÏÍø¹ÙÍø School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 55%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 56%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 18%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).

Leland ºÚÁÏÍø¹ÙÍø School's student population of 433 students has declined by 16% over five school years.
The teacher population of 32 teachers has declined by 11% over five school years.
